The Prepar3d Forum
The Prepar3d Forum is a forum for Lockheed's Prepar3d simulation software. Quoting Lockheed Martin; "Prepar3D furthers the development of Microsoft® ESP™ while maintaining compatibility with Microsoft Flight Simulator X, allowing many thousands of add-ons to be used within Prepar3D." This forum is for general user-to-user discussions. Official support for this product can be obtained at Lockheed Martin. Website - https://www.prepar3d.com/

I tried to install several of my purchased aircraft, but only the A2A installer was able to install planes like the J3 Cub or C182. Unfortunately you will receive a Crash to Desktop, when starting P3D5 and choosing one of those A2A planes. Fortunately in their forum they say: Delete the windshield.dll file and I can confirm: That's it. Simply search in your Windows Explorer for that file and delete it. Theres a new one everytime you install another A2A plane 😉 Ralf
